136 2007-01-16 Tor Lillqvist <tml@novell.com>
138 * gthread-win32.c (g_gettime_win32_impl):
139 GetSystemTimeAsFileTime() returns 100s of nanoseconds since 1601,
140 so offset to Unix epoch (1970) and multiply by 100 to get
141 nanoseconds which is what we want.

211 2006-02-20 Tor Lillqvist <tml@novell.com>
213 * gthread-win32.c (g_thread_exit_win32_impl): Make the
214 implementation of GPrivate behave more closely as in POSIX
215 threads: The value associacted with a GPrivate must be set to NULL
216 before calling the destructor. (The destructor gets the original
217 value as argument.) A destructor might re-associate a non-NULL
218 value with some GPrivate. To deal with this, if after all
219 destructors have been called, there still are some non-NULL
220 values, the process is repeated. (#331367)

391 2001-09-28 Tor Lillqvist <tml@iki.fi>
393 * gthread-win32.c: Use an extra level of indirection for GMutex.
394 It is now a pointer either to a pointer to a CRITICAL_SECTION
395 struct, or to a mutex HANDLE. This is needed in case the user
396 defines G_ERRORCHECK_MUTEXES. G_MUTEX_SIZE must correctly reflect
397 the size of *GMutex, but this used to vary depending on whether we
398 at run-time chose to use CRITICAL_SECTIONs or mutexes.
399 (g_mutex_free_win32_cs_impl, g_cond_free_win32_impl): Call
400 DeleteCriticalSection() when done with it.
402 * gthread-impl.c (g_thread_init_with_errorcheck_mutexes): Call
403 g_thread_impl_init() before accessing
404 g_thread_functions_for_glib_use_default, as the
405 g_thread_impl_init() function might modify it.

632 1999-11-16 Sebastian Wilhelmi <wilhelmi@ira.uka.de>
634 * gthread-posix.c, gthread-solaris.c: Changed the prototype of
635 thread_create and thread_self to return the system thread into
636 provided memory instead of a return value. This is necessary, as
637 HPUX has a pthread_t, that is bigger than the biggest integral
638 type there. Made some more functions static.
640 * gthread-posix.c: Small fixes for DCE threads: Detaching has to
641 be done after thread creation for DCE.
